Duties and Responsibilities
Collecting information and reporting on security matters
Conducting preliminary investigations and recording statements
Controlling traffic flow and crowd during County events
Assisting in customer care desk staff in receiving and directing visitors to the relevant offices Hoisting of flags
Responding to distress calls from the public
Guarding and securing County Government buildings and vital installations
Screening people and vehicles entering county offices and public places
Ensuring compliance with county laws in conjunction with other law enforcement agencies
Execute all orders and warrants lawfully issued to county law breakers and giving evidence in court
Maintaining order and sanity in markets, bus parks and other county premises
Conducting frequent inspections on regulated activities to ensure compliance
Assisting in disaster management and response
Any other duty that maybe assigned by the superiors
Requirements for Appointment
Be a Kenyan Citizen (Attach ID)
KCPE (Attache Certificate)
Minimum Kenya Certificate of Secondary Education (KCSE) Mean Grade of D+ (plus) or its equivalent from the Kenya National Examination Council
(KNEC) or equivalent examination bodies (Attach Certificate)
Must be physically fit
Must be medically fit (Attach a valid medical report from a recognized government health facility)
Have no criminal record and any pending criminal charges (Attach a valid Good Conduct)
Must be between 20 - 35 years.
National Youth Service (NYS) or any security certificate from recognized institutions will be an added advantage (Attach valid NYS Discharge Certificate/Certificate).
